Analysis

Oman recorded 10,469 t for printing and writing papers, uncoated, woodfree β€” import quantity in 2024.

That represents a change of down 19.6% on the previous year and down 11.5% over ten years.

Over the whole period, printing and writing papers, uncoated, woodfree β€” import quantity in Oman peaked at 20,500 t in 2001 and was at its lowest, 5,344 t, in 1999.

Oman ranks 107th of 220 countries on this measure, in the middle of the range.

The long-run direction has been consistently rising across the 27 years of available data.

The database contains data on the production and trade in roundwood and in primary wood and paper products for all countries and territories in the world.The main types of primary forest products included in this database are roundwood, sawnwood, wood-based panels, pulp, and paper and paperboard. These products are detailed further and defined in the Joint Forest Sector Questionnaire (JFSQ) (https://www.fao.org/statistics/data-collection/forestry/en). The database contains details of the following topics: - roundwood removals (production) by coniferous and non-coniferous wood and assortments, - production and trade in industrial roundwood, sawnwood, wood-based panels, wood charcoal, pulp, paper and paperboard, and other products.
